The interior angle angles of a triangle add up to...? 

The sum of the interior angles of a triangle is equal to 180 degrees.

What does the exterior angle theorem for triangles state?
The measures of an exterior angle is a triangle is equal to the sum of the measures of the two remote interior angles.

In triangle ABC, the measure of an exterior angle at vertex C is 120°. One of the remote interior angles is 45°. Using the Exterior Angle Theorem, find the measure of the other remote interior angle

What is 75 degrees.
